Mauricio Pochettino revealed that Davinson Sanchez had already defied his expectations since joining Tottenham in the summer, and the 21-year-old will no doubt be even better next season.

In his press conference ahead of Saturday’s game against Stoke City, the Spurs manager shared that the 21-year-old defender had taken to life in the Premier League quicker than he expected.

Journalist Ben Pearce shared the news from Pochettino’s conference on Friday via his personal Twitter account:

Sanchez arrived in London from Ajax in the summer after Spurs paid £42million for his services, as reported by the BBC.

The 21-year-old centre-back has since made 36 appearances across all competitions and has looked like a great signing in his outings.

Sanchez has had a few worrying moments in a Spurs shirt, such as the game against Bournemouth when he was dispossessed a few times and caught out of position on multiple occasions.

Also in the match against Juventus in Turin earlier in the season, Sanchez showed how nerves could affect his performance as he hesitated to make tackles in that game.

However given the fact that Pochettino stated Sanchez’s willingness to learn, all these errors will be gone from his future displays.

The 21-year-old will be a much-improved player next season, not just from learning from his mistakes, but due to the fact he can start the campaign quicker as he will know the Premier League this time around.

Sanchez will also no doubt shine brighter next season due to Spurs being resigned to lose Toby Alderweireld in the summer, as previously reported by Belgian newspaper HLN.

Without the 29-year-old defender overshadowing him, Sanchez will step-up his displays in order for fans not to be disappointed over losing the experienced centre-back.

With all this in mind Pochettino may claim that Sanchez has already defied expectations at the club, but next season the 21-year-old will be a revelation compared to his campaign.
